Dell Vostro 15 3530 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Processor13th Gen Intel Core i3/i5/i7
RAMUp to 16GB DDR4
StorageUp to 1TB SSD
Display15.6-inch FHD (1920x1080)
GraphicsNVIDIA® GeForce® MX550
Operating SystemWindows 11 Pro
Ports1 HDMI 1.4 port
WirelessBluetooth
Camera720p HD camera
AudioStereo speakers
Battery3 Cell, 41 Wh, ExpressCharge™, battery
